About Dream Touch - Tulip Bulbs (Double Late)

Tulipa

Seed Type Bulb
Plant Type Double Late

Is it a peony? A rose? Or a tulip? Dream Touch is truly a stand-out. It has a thin strip of white edging along soft purple petals, giving it an especially delicate quality. Try planting it alongside other white flowers and see how the white accent really pops. Like all tulips, this one has long sturdy stems that are perfect for cut flower arrangements.

Planting Information

Planting Dream Touch - Tulip Bulbs (Double Late)

Planting Season Fall
Light Requirement Full Sun, Partial Shade
Planting Depth 6 to 8 inches
Plant Height 14 to 20 inches
Plant Spacing 6 inches
Water Needs Low
Hardiness Zones 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8
Bulb Size 11-12 cm circumference
